Stone Roses star John Squire to showcase paintings with new London exhibition

Robert Dex @RobDexES6 August 2019

The Stone Roses guitarist John Squire is showing a series of paintings at Damien Hirst’s gallery.

The musician created oil paintings by taking photos and then distorting and enlarging them before copying the results on to canvas.

Included in the show is this image, The Way Things Aren’t, 2018, photographed by Prudence Cuming Associates.

Squire rose to fame in the band whose debut album is seen as a modern classic. He designed the Stone Roses’ album and single covers and promotional posters.

The exhibition, Disinformation, is at Newport Street Gallery in Vauxhall from September 11 to November 10.
